The tip for Win10x64: In order to avoid repetitive DXGI_device errors that stop & restart the video driver, set up the Gothic2.exe compatibility options as shown in the attachment...! I am using the 15.8b Catalysts (have no idea whether this applies to nVidia gpus, sorry.)
I have no idea why this works while still rendering the game in 32-bits, but it does. I found one other game that requires this as well...Post Mortem.
Applying this simple fix completely solved the crashes I was getting w/ the 17.1 D3d11 G2 rendering package. The game has never looked or played this well. Have fun!
